On Tuesday 27 February 2007 08:57:59 pm Don Raboud wrote:
In my case, not only was automatic spellchecking turn off, but for some
reason KMail also defaulted to composing all messages as HTML. It took me
some time to finally figure out how to turn that feature off (the same
options menu in the composition window).
Ahh, cleverly set in an options menu (as opposed to the Settings menu) to fool
us into writing goofy emails!
I have it now.
Compose (or forward or reply) email > Options > Automatic Spellchecking.
I think it doesn't work when HTML is enabled - at least it said so in the
manual. I refuse to write messages in HTML.
